What is the purpose of an extended warranty?
The purpose of extended warranties is to offer coverage for the cost of specified repairs your vehicle may need in the future. Extended warranties typically begin when the manufacturer’s warranty expires, but sometimes these plans overlap.
What is normally covered under extended warranty?
An extended warranty is actually an insurance policy on your vehicle, a safeguard against expensive, unforeseen repairs. It covers repairs for an agreed-upon period of time and miles. True warranties, though, are included in the price of the product.
Is extended warranty worth buying?
An extended car warranty may help cover the cost of certain repairs to your vehicle when the manufacturer’s warranty expires, but they’re not for everyone. Plus, many people who buy extended warranties never use them. In that case, an extended warranty becomes a cost with no financial return.
Will extended warranty cover engine?
Generally, your warranty will cover major mechanical components like the engine, the transmission and major moving parts like the drive axle. Hybrid cars sometimes come with a warranty to specifically cover the hybrid power system & batteries.

Is a car battery covered under warranty?
Car batteries are considered “wear & tear” items, like tires, brake pads and motor oil, so they are not typically covered by extended warranties. However, batteries do typically come with their own warranty coverage.
